House Passes Red-Light Camera Repeal 59-57
The House passed a measure backed by Rep. Richard Corcoran, R-New Port Richey, which would repeal the bill on red-light cameras passed in the 2010 session. The repeal measure passed by the slimmest of margins59 to 57.
Nothing like a little drama on Monday on Week 9, said Speaker Dean Cannon, R-Winter Park, after reading the results.

Space Shuttle Endeavor Lift-Off Moved Back Until at Least Sunday
While the last flight of the space shuttle Endeavor was supposed to be Friday, the launch was canceled due to concerns over a heater circuit. While initially there was talk about moving the launch to Sunday and then Monday, NASA administrators are now insisting that the earliest the shuttle will take off will be Sunday, May 8. In the meantime, the six astronauts are heading back to Texas for more training.

Florida Senate Applauds bin Laden's Death
Before embarking on the last week of the legislative session, the Florida Senate took time to recognize the momentous killing of Osama bin Laden late Sunday.
"Iwant to applaud the incredible forces that carried out this mission. I also want to applaud Barack Obama, our commander in chief [for a] job well done," Senate President Mike Haridopolos, R-Merritt Island, said to open up the Senate session Monday. The statement elicited a round of applause from his fellow senators, staffers, and people in the gallery.

Florida's Leaders React to American Forces Taking Out Osama bin Laden
With news that American forces killed Osama bin Laden in Pakistan, Floridas leaders cheered the news late Sunday.
Bin Laden killed!, cheered Rep. Joe Felix Diaz, R-Miami. Tonight the world is a safer place. God bless the U.S.A.
Death of Osama Bin Laden is a long-awaited victory in the war on terror, noted former U.S. Sen. George LeMieux who is running in the Republican primary for the U.S. Senate in 2012. Let's remember in this moment those that died on 9/11.

Mike Haridopolos Responds to News of RPOF Chair's Illness
It emerged Friday that Dave Bitner, who was elected chairman of the Republican Party of Florida in January, was diagnosed with ALS, or Lou Gehrig's disease.
Senate President Mike Haridopolos, R-Merritt Island, issued the following statement in support of Bitner and his family:
"Stephanie and I today send our love and support to Republican Party of Florida Chairman Dave Bitner and his wife Wendy. Chairman Bitner is a good man and I know hes prepared for the days ahead of him.
